What is CD4075BE used for?
The CD4075BE is widely used in digital logic design for combining multiple binary signals in PLCs, industrial automation controllers, and embedded microcontroller interface circuits. It serves as a glue-logic component in legacy and new CMOS designs requiring OR operations across sensor inputs, interrupt logic, or bus arbitration. The DIP-14 through-hole package makes it ideal for prototyping, educational electronics, and repair of existing industrial equipment.

What are the key electrical specifications of the CD4075BE?
The CD4075BE operates with a typical CMOS supply range (3V–18V), features 3 independent 3-input OR gates, a maximum output sink current (I_ol) of 6.8mA, and a rated load capacitance of 50pF. It is housed in a 14-pin DIP package and is RoHS (Pb-free) compliant.
What are common applications for the CD4075BE OR gate?
CD4075BE is commonly used in industrial control systems, embedded logic interfaces, interrupt request combining circuits, signal routing in PLCs, and digital prototyping. Its triple OR gate structure allows consolidation of multiple logic functions in a single low-cost CMOS package.
Is the CD4075BE compatible with TTL logic levels and other CMOS families?
The CD4075BE is a CD4000-series CMOS device and is directly compatible with other 4000/14000/40000 CMOS logic families. With appropriate supply voltage, its outputs can interface with TTL logic, though a pull-up resistor or level shifter may be needed for full TTL compatibility at 5V.
What package does the CD4075BE come in, and are there surface-mount alternatives?
The CD4075BE is available in a 14-pin PDIP (Dual In-Line Package) through-hole format, indicated by the JESD-30 code R-PDIP-T14. For surface-mount applications, Texas Instruments offers equivalent devices such as the CD4075BM in SOIC or the CD4075BPWR in TSSOP packages.
